
USS The Sullivans, which fought in WWII, partially sinks in Buffalo
Fox News
The U.S.S. Sullivans, a decommissioned Navy warship, has partially sunk in waters near Buffalo, New York.
"The USS Sullivans is a National Historic Landmark and a true Western New York treasure. Just ten days ago, on the 79th anniversary of the vessel's launch, we announced $490,000 in federal funding to support repairs needed to protect the ship and the incredible history that goes with it," said Rep. Brian Higgins of New York.
